Photonics: Devices, Systems and Sensors

“Photonics: Devices, Systems and Sensors” by Juan Landers, published by NY Research Press on June 26, 2019, offers an in-depth exploration of the scientific study of light generation, detection, and manipulation. Spanning 219 pages, this edition delves into the processes of emission, modulation, and amplification of light, as well as the transmission and properties of photons. The book examines the significant applications of photonics in various fields, including information processing, telecommunications, and laser technology.
Readers will find a thorough analysis of innovative and unexplored aspects of photonics, with a focus on the advancements that are shaping this rapidly evolving field. The text includes case studies that provide insights into the applications of photonic devices, such as data recording and sensor technology, which detect environmental changes and relay signals for further analysis. This comprehensive guide serves as a valuable resource for anyone interested in understanding the complexities and developments within the realm of photonics.

Photonics is the scientific study of generation, detection and manipulation of light through processes of emission, modulation, amplification, etc. It also studies the transmission and properties of photons. The applications of photonics are in the areas of information processing, telecommunications, spectroscopy, lasers, etc. Important applications of photonic devices are in data recording, laser printing and displays. Sensor is a type of photonic device that detects the change in its immediate environment and sends the signals further to other electronic systems for analysis. There has been rapid progress in this field and its applications are finding their way across multiple industries. This book brings forth some of the most innovative and unexplored aspects of photonics. The various studies that are constantly contributing towards advancing technologies and evolution of this field are examined in detail. For all readers who are interested in photonics, the case studies in this book will serve as an excellent guide to develop a comprehensive understanding.
